In which Project Cost Management process is work performance data included?

The correct answer is D. Control Costs. Work performance data is an input exclusively to the Control Costs process, where actual cost data is compared against the cost baseline to assess project performance.

Why each option

Work performance data is an input exclusively to the Control Costs process, where actual cost data is compared against the cost baseline to assess project performance.

APlan Cost Management

Plan Cost Management is a planning process that establishes policies and procedures for managing costs; it does not use work performance data as an input.

BEstimate Costs

Estimate Costs is a planning process focused on approximating costs of resources; it does not receive work performance data.

CDetermine Budget

Determine Budget aggregates cost estimates to establish the cost baseline; it is also a planning process and does not use work performance data.

DControl CostsCorrect

Control Costs is a monitoring and controlling process that receives work performance data - such as actual costs incurred - as a key input to calculate variances and forecasts. It uses this raw data to produce work performance information, including cost variance (CV) and schedule variance (SV). The other cost management processes occur before execution and therefore do not consume work performance data.
